Civil and Administrative Tribunal New South Wales Medium Neutral Citation: Health Care Complaints Commission v Chen [2023] NSWCATOD 184 Hearing dates: 7 and 8 November 2023 Date of orders: 14 December 2023 Decision date: 14 December 2023 Jurisdiction: Occupational Division Before: H J Dixon SC, Senior Member E Pun, Senior Member J Lee, Senior Member R Kusuma, General Member Decision: 1. An order under s 149C(1)(b) of the Health Practitioner Regulation National Law (NSW), the registration of the Respondent is cancelled. 2. Under s 149C(7) of the Health Practitioner Regulation National Law (NSW), a non-review period of two years is imposed. 3. Under clause 13 of Schedule 5D of the Health Practitioner Regulation National Law (NSW), the Respondent is to pay the Applicant's costs as agreed or assessed. Catchwords: OCCUPATIONS – Chinese Medicine practitioner – misconduct and discipline – criminal findings – failure by the practitioner to notify the National Board – professional misconduct Legislation Cited: Civil and Administrative Tribunal Act 2013, s 64 Crimes Act 1900, ss 61L, 61N(2) Crimes (Sentencing Procedure) Act 1999, s 9(1)(b) Health Practitioner Regulation National Law (NSW), ss 3(2), 3A(1), 109(1), 130(1), 139B(1), 139E, 144, 149C, 150, 150C, cl 13 of Sch 5D Cases Cited: Health Care Complaints Commission v Amalakumar [2019] NSWCATOD 173 Health Care Complaints Commission v Chowdhury [2015] NSWCATOD 65 Health Care Complaints Commission v Do [2014] NSWCA 307 Health Care Complaints Commission v Liu [2016] NSWCATOD 133 Health Care Complaints Commission v Marsh [2016] NSWCATOD 155 Health Care Complaints Commission v Philipiah [2013] NSWCA 342 Texts Cited: None cited Category: Principal judgment Parties: Health Care Complaints Commission (Applicant) Mu Ping Chen (Respondent) Representation: Counsel: A Chhabra (Applicant)
